What Is Customer Lifetime Value, Really?

Customer lifetime value measures what one customer is worth over their entire relationship with you, not just their first purchase. It gets confused with a few neighboring metrics, so let’s separate them.

LTV is usually shorthand for the same thing as CLV. Some teams use it interchangeably; others reserve LTV for SaaS-specific, subscription-based calculations. Don’t stress over the distinction. ARPU (average revenue per user) is a single-period snapshot, usually monthly, and it’s one of the inputs that feeds CLV rather than a replacement for it. CAC (customer acquisition cost) is the mirror image: what it costs you to win a customer, not what they’re worth once won.

Here’s where each version earns its keep:

  • Revenue-based CLV works for board decks and top-line growth conversations.
  • Margin-adjusted CLV (revenue minus cost of goods and delivery) is what should drive your CAC budgeting, because a customer worth $2,000 in revenue but $200 in profit changes your math entirely.
  • Cohort-level CLV is what you need for real growth experiments, since blended averages hide which customer group is actually driving value.

Historical CLV vs. Predictive CLV: Which One Should You Trust?

Historical (observed) CLV looks backward. You take real transaction data from customers who’ve already churned or who’ve been around long enough to trust the pattern, and you calculate what they actually spent. It’s simple, defensible, and immune to modeling errors. Its weakness: it tells you nothing about customers who signed up last month.

Predictive (modeled) CLV looks forward. It uses statistical techniques like survival analysis or machine learning to estimate what a new customer will likely spend before you have years of data on them. It’s more useful for planning but carries model risk. A bad churn assumption compounds into a badly wrong number.

Stage Recommended approach Why
Seed / pre-PMF Historical, cohort-based Data is too thin for reliable modeling
Growth Blend of historical + light predictive Enough data to trend, not enough for full ML
Scale Predictive modeling Volume supports statistical confidence
  • At seed stage, trust what happened, not what a model predicts.
  • At growth stage, use predictive estimates for planning but validate them against real cohort data monthly.

Why Customer Lifetime Value Should Drive Your Decisions

CLV isn’t a vanity metric for the annual report. It’s the number that should sit next to every major decision you make.

Consider three scenarios. If your CLV is substantially higher than your CAC, you have room to spend more aggressively on acquisition than a competitor with a lower ratio. If a proposed feature costs three months of engineering time but doesn’t move retention, CLV tells you it’s probably not worth building yet. If a loyalty program costs $15 per customer per year, CLV tells you almost immediately whether that spend pays for itself.

CLV also connects directly to your unit economics and revenue forecasting. A business with rising CLV and flat CAC is compounding in your favor. One with flat CLV and rising CAC is quietly eroding.

  • Report CLV alongside CAC and payback period every month, not once a year.
  • Treat a declining CLV trend as an early warning system, not just a lagging scorecard.

How to Calculate Customer Lifetime Value: Three Methods

You have three real options, ranked by effort and precision.

Comparison chart of CLV calculation methods

1. The simple formula. Multiply average purchase value by purchase frequency, then multiply that by average customer lifespan:

CLV = (Average Purchase Value × Purchase Frequency) × Average Customer Lifespan

For subscription businesses, the common SaaS shortcut is ARPU divided by your monthly churn rate, which gives you the expected total revenue per customer. Add a gross-margin multiplier if you want a profit view instead of a revenue view. That margin-adjusted version is usually the one that should inform actual spending decisions, since revenue-only CLV can make a low-margin customer look far more valuable than they are.

2. Cohort analysis. Group customers by the month or quarter they signed up, then track how each group’s revenue and retention evolve separately. This avoids the classic blended-churn trap: new customers often churn at a much higher rate in their first few months than long-tenured ones, and averaging them together can inflate your apparent CLV. Cohort math takes longer to set up but tells you the truth about where value actually comes from.

Hands arranging customer cohort cards

3. Predictive modeling. Survival analysis estimates the probability a customer stays active in any given period. Discounted cash flow (DCF) models bring future revenue back to today’s dollars, useful when you’re pitching investors on long-term value. Both require enough historical data to calibrate. If you don’t have a data scientist on staff, most SaaS LTV calculators will run simple, margin-adjusted, and DCF versions side by side so you can compare.

Whichever method you pick, you’ll need these inputs pulled from your systems:

  • Average order value or ARPU from your billing platform
  • Purchase or renewal frequency from your CRM
  • Monthly or annual churn rate from your analytics tool
  • Gross margin per customer or per plan tier

What Data Do You Need to Measure CLV Accurately?

Good CLV math starts with clean inputs, not a fancier formula. You need five numbers: average order value, purchase frequency, retention or churn rate, gross margin, and CAC. Miss one and the whole calculation drifts.

Pull them from the systems you already run:

  • Payment platform (Stripe, for instance) for transaction-level revenue and refund data
  • CRM for purchase frequency and account-level history
  • Analytics tool for cohort retention curves
  • Billing system for churn and plan-tier data

Use a 12 to 24 month lookback window where possible. Shorter windows undersell lifespan; much longer windows can bake in outdated pricing or product versions.

Pro Tip: Deduplicate accounts before you calculate anything. A single customer with two logins or two billing records will quietly inflate your purchase frequency and distort every number downstream.

How to Increase Customer Lifetime Value: A Prioritized Playbook

Not every lever is worth pulling first. Here’s the order that tends to pay off fastest for early-stage teams.

  1. Reduce churn. This is usually the highest-leverage move, since it costs six to seven times less to keep a customer than to acquire a new one, and a 5% retention improvement can raise profitability by roughly 25%. Test onboarding improvements, proactive check-ins, or a win-back sequence for at-risk accounts.
  2. Raise average order value. Bundling and tiered pricing are the two most common moves here. A subscription box that bundles three products at a slight discount often lifts AOV without hurting perceived value.
  3. Increase purchase frequency. Loyalty programs, replenishment reminders, and usage-based nudges all push existing customers to buy or engage more often.
  4. Revisit pricing and packaging. Sometimes the fastest CLV lift is simply charging closer to the value you deliver, particularly if you’ve added features since your last price review.

For each lever, set a measurement window before you launch it.

  • Watch churn or AOV weekly for the first month, not just at quarter-end.
  • Flag the risk each lever carries: price changes can spike short-term churn even while raising long-term CLV, so don’t panic at week one.

What LTV:CAC Ratio Should You Aim For?

The standard benchmark is an LTV:CAC ratio near 3:1 for scalable businesses. Below 1:1, you’re losing money on every customer. Between 1:1 and 3:1, you’re viable but thin. Above 3:1, especially closer to 5:1, you may be under-investing in growth and leaving market share on the table.

Benchmark ranges vary by model. SaaS businesses with strong margins often target 3:1 to 5:1. Ecommerce, with thinner margins and shorter customer lifespans, frequently runs closer to 2:1 to 3:1. Enterprise sales, with long payback periods, can justify lower ratios if the absolute contract value is large enough.

Common mistakes when reading this ratio:

  • Ignoring payback period, which can hide a healthy ratio built on a dangerously slow cash cycle.
  • Using revenue-based CLV instead of margin-adjusted CLV, which flatters the ratio.
  • Mixing cohorts with very different churn profiles into one blended number.

Treat both sides of the ratio as dynamic, not fixed. CAC creeps up as channels saturate; CLV shifts as your product and pricing evolve. Re-check quarterly.

What Tools Should You Use to Track CLV by Stage?

You don’t need enterprise software to start. Match the tool to where you actually are.

  • Pre-product-market-fit: A spreadsheet with three tabs, cohorts, monthly revenue, and churn, is enough to get a directionally correct number.
  • Growth stage: Analytics platforms with built-in cohort views let you automate retention curves instead of rebuilding them by hand each month.
  • Scale stage: Predictive SaaS or ML-based modeling becomes worth the investment once you have enough volume for statistical confidence.

Before reaching for anything advanced, run the basics: monthly cohort revenue, churn by signup month, and a simple margin-adjusted CLV calculation. A curated list of founder-friendly tools can help you avoid over-buying software before you’ve validated the basics manually.

Where Customer Lifetime Value Calculations Go Wrong

Most CLV mistakes come from convenient shortcuts, not bad math.

  • Blended churn. Averaging all customers together hides the fact that new signups often churn faster than tenured ones.
  • Revenue instead of margin. A high-revenue customer with thin margins can look more valuable than they actually are.
  • Mixing cohorts. Combining customers acquired through different channels or pricing tiers muddies the signal.
  • Short lookback windows. A 30-day window will systematically undersell lifespan and CLV.

Run this quick validation check before trusting a number: recalculate CLV by cohort, apply your gross margin, and flag any outlier accounts skewing the average.
